Actor Jeremy Renner suffered “blunt chest trauma and orthopedic injuries” after a New Year’s Day snow plowing accident.
The actor was reportedly using a plowing machine called a ‘Snowcat’ at the time of the incident. The machine accidentally ran over one of his legs, causing Renner to lose a lot of blood at the scene. His neighbor, who is a doctor, is being credited for quickly rushing to his aid and potentially saving his life. The neighbor tended to his injury, putting a tourniquet on his leg to help stop the bleeding until first responders and a helicopter arrived to airlift the actor to the hospital.
The ‘Avengers’ star had surgery yesterday and “remains in the intensive care unit in critical but stable condition."
